Its interesting how the definition of "beginner bike" has evolved. My first bike was a 1966 Honda 90 with 5 HP. I started riding in 1967 when I was 14 years old. This was the minimum age for a bike in Oklahoma. The maximum power that a bike could have if you were under 16 years old was 5 HP. At the age of 14, a 300 cc bike would have been gigantic to me. 48 HP would have been unimaginable.

In the UK if you're 16-17 you can have a 50cc Scotter that makes out around 30-50mph (stock) at 17-19 you can get a A2 that let's you ride a 125Kw(14.9hp) bike as long as you do a Cbt and have L plates on the bike. from ages 19-21 you can have an A2 license that let's you have a 20KW (27BHP) to 35kw (47BHP) You can actually ride a motorcycle of any CC, however, it must be restricted to no more than 35kw (47bhp) ~it's a little strange they go of Kilowatt hours but It means some older big CC bikes can be ridden without restriction ~ finally age at age 21 you can do you're full bike licence for any bike..

Not sure the Ninja 250 deserves any hate. When I first got my license in 2000 I could either afford a used bike or a brand new Ninja 250 for the same price. Just over 3000 and I loved that bike for a year and a half till I was ready to step up. Did I take it to the SoCal canyons? No. But it handled the freeways and surface streets with ease, including riding it at least once a week to work, which was 45 miles each way, mostly freeway and it was perfect. I think for the times, when ALL bikes were pretty much carbs, it was perfect as a first bike. Light and tossable, enough power to really learn without getting yourself into trouble. And after that year and a half I traded it in, got 2500 and put that towards a new ZX-6R. Stepped up to that and had no issues. If I had it to do over again, I would have done it just the same. All that being said, it sure would have been nice if the Ninja 400 or KTM 390 existed back then:)

You are also forgetting that there were 250cc bikes in the 1990s that had 4 cylinders like the suzuki gsx-r250 or the yamaha fzr250 or the cbr250rr or the Kawasaki zxr250... All those beginner sport bikes had 45+hp even if carburated and revved beyond 17k rpms, so other than abs and fuel injection I think there could be better beginner bikes
